1 Frying peppers per person;
(long & light green in
color) (up to 2)
Rice
Tomato sauce
Chopped onion; (to taste)
Sliced garlic; (to taste)
Oil or cooking spray
Chicken; (enough for
everyone)
Water to cover
Healthy pinch of sugar;
(about 1 tsp.) so sauce
won't be bitter
source: I concocted this
Cut off top of peppers & scoop out seeds. Fill about 2/3 with raw rice.
Sauté onion & garlic in a bit of oil until tender crisp. Add chicken parts,
stand up peppers around & inbetween, add tomato sauce & water to barely
cover. Tightly cover pot, bring to a boil and simmer gently until done.
I used to make this Friday afternoon just before Shabbos and after cooking
for a little while would place on the blech until dinner. It was delicious.
You could add dill, parsley, other vegetables as you wish. You could also
make it without the chicken but it does add flavor. Enjoy!
